If the failure is similar to what we usually see,...

If the failure is similar to what we usually see, you won't notice much of anything, except maybe slightly higher revs when the clutch really wears out. The torque converter will operate normally as...

I think the Automatic in the Boxster S is a...

I think the Automatic in the Boxster S is a derivative of the ZF 5HP19, which is found in a good number of Audi's. We've found the torque converter clutches wear out often in these, particularly in...
